as posted by the channelAccording to Donald Trump's former Defense Secretary Mark Esper, Trump wanted to bomb the country of Mexico in order to destroy "drug labs" and then deny that it was the US that did the bombing. Obviously this idea never became a reality, but this admission shows just how mad Trump had become with the power that he had as President. Farron Cousins explains what happened.
